Stagewright renders seat maps for the Orpharion Theatre booking flow. Clone the repo, install Node 20, and run `npm ci`. The renderer reads venue geometry from the `halls` schema; seed fixtures live in `fixtures/orpharion.json` and load via `npm run seed`. Hot reload works through `npm run dev` on port 4173. Do not edit generated SVG layers by hand — regenerate with `npm run layers`. Tests require the seed data present. Before starting the dev server, point the app at your local Postgres instance using the connection string below.

primary connection of yagep-kahip = redis://giliel_svc:zYiKsLL2PLpfPL@db-348f.xolmarsys.corp:5432/fenwyn

This PR hardens Spoolwright, our printer-spooler microservice, against job floods from the Cantervale kiosks. Changes: bounded the inbound queue, added per-tenant rate limits, and made dead-letter sweeps configurable. No API changes; existing clients are unaffected. New folks: all knobs live in one module so staging overrides stay simple. Values were chosen from last month's load test. The defaults introduced by this PR are below.

tuning constants:
BUDGETS = {
    "druath": 240,
    "lamwyn": 180,
    "silael": 275,
}

Handover: Bramblewick assignment service (from Odile to Tarn). Nothing is on fire, but watch the enrollment cache — if it goes cold, users flip between experiment arms, and support will see "inconsistent pricing" tickets. Restart the cache warmer before anything else; a redeploy is almost never needed. Cache warmer steps and verification queries are on the internal ops page.

dashboard of bafof-hafog = https://confluence.lumiclabs.internal/display/browse/display/6a09a20a